Output 135aa59b775e7efe9076ecce1e9aa70aeb2461b1c027bf698cf9e7cb38995052:0

value
334094069
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d21a29d300f1a768d7b95c8a41b5950cc385e63 OP_EQUALVERIFY OP_CHECKSIG
address
19VS8rdSStZHtcgtowtrwWYuowZLAq9osn
transaction
135aa59b775e7efe9076ecce1e9aa70aeb2461b1c027bf698cf9e7cb38995052
spent
true